/*1400 / 1366 / 1200 / 1024-1080 / 992 / 768 / 480 / 320
#block_laptop
#block_laptop_1080
#block_mobile
*/
.block_mobile {
	display:none !important;
}
	
.block_laptop {
	display:block !important;
}

/************************************************************************************
НОУТБУКИ И МАЛЕНЬКИЕ МОНИТОРЫ
*************************************************************************************/
@media only screen and (max-width: 1420px) {
.block_mobile_1420 {
	display:block !important;
}
	
.block_laptop_1420 {
	display:none !important;
}

}


/************************************************************************************
smaller than 1200 px
*************************************************************************************/
@media only screen and (max-width: 1200px) {
.block_mobile_1200 {
	display:block !important;
}
	
.block_laptop_1200 {
	display:none !important;
}

	
	
}

/************************************************************************************
РАЗРЕШЕНИЕ ДЛЯ ПЛАНШЕТОВ И МОБИЛЬНЫХ 1080px
*************************************************************************************/
@media only screen and (max-width: 1080px) {
.block_mobile_1080 {
	display:block !important;
}
	
.block_laptop_1080 {
	display:none !important;
}

.navbar-default .navbar-nav > li > a {
    font-size: 14px;
}   
    
.offer-right {
    min-height: 350px;
}
    
.offer-right p {
    margin: 10px 0px;
    line-height: 22px;
    font-size: 13px;
}
    
.offer {
    background-color: #ffc155;        
    }
    
.about p {
    font-size: 10px;
    line-height: 17px;
}
	
}



/************************************************************************************
РАЗРЕШЕНИЕ ДЛЯ ПЛАНШЕТОВ И МОБИЛЬНЫХ 992px
*************************************************************************************/
@media only screen and (max-width: 992px) {
.block_mobile_992 {
	display:block !important;
}
	
.block_laptop_992 {
	display:none !important;
}


}

/************************************************************************************
РАЗРЕШЕНИЕ ДЛЯ ПЛАНШЕТОВ И МОБИЛЬНЫХ 768px
*************************************************************************************/
@media only screen and (max-width: 768px) {
.block_mobile_768 {
	display:block !important;
}
	
.block_laptop_768 {
	display:none !important;
}

.navbar-default .navbar-nav > li > a {
    font-size: 10px;
} 
    
.contakt p {
    font-size: 11px;
}

.contakt p.tell {
    font-size: 19px;
}
    
.banner-text p {
    font-size: 10px;
}
    
.about p {
    font-size: 12px;
    line-height: 21px;
}
    
p.catDescr {
    font-size: 9px;
    line-height: 13px;
}
    
	
}

/************************************************************************************
РАЗРЕШЕНИЕ ДЛЯ МОБИЛЬНЫХ 600px
*************************************************************************************/
@media only screen and (max-width: 600px) {
.block_mobile_600 {
	display:block !important;
}
	
.block_laptop_600 {
	display:none !important;
}
    
.navbar-default .navbar-nav > li > a {
    font-size: 14px;
} 

.banner-text {
    width: 100%;
}
    
.banner-text {
    margin-left:0px;
}
    
.katalog-popup {
    width: 97%;
}
    
.modal-dialog {
    margin-left:1.5%;
}
    
img.catLook {
    display: block;
    height: 93px;
    width: auto;
    margin: 0 auto;
}
    
}





/************************************************************************************
РАЗРЕШЕНИЕ ДЛЯ МОБИЛЬНЫХ 480px
*************************************************************************************/
@media only screen and (max-width: 480px) {
.block_mobile_480 {
	display:block !important;
}
	
.block_laptop_480 {
	display:none !important;
}
    
.contakt {
    float: none; 
    width: 95%;
    text-align: right;
}

    
.banner-text a {
    font-size: 10px;
}
    
a.form_head {
    display: block;
    width: 170px;
    margin: 15px auto;
    padding: 10px;
    padding-left: 50px;
    border-radius: 50px;
    background: url(../images/icons.png) no-repeat 19px -37px #c44405;
    font-weight: 300;
    color: #fff;
}
    
    
    
}


/************************************************************************************
РАЗРЕШЕНИЕ ДЛЯ МОБИЛЬНЫХ 375px
*************************************************************************************/
@media only screen and (max-width: 375px) {
.block_mobile_375 {
	display:block !important;
}
	
.block_laptop_375 {
	display:none !important;
}
    
 
  
    
    

}




/************************************************************************************
РАЗРЕШЕНИЕ ДЛЯ МОБИЛЬНЫХ 320px
*************************************************************************************/
@media only screen and (max-width: 320px) {
.block_mobile_320 {
	display:block !important;
}
	
.block_laptop_320 {
	display:none !important;
}
 
    

}




/*==========  Mobile First Method  ==========*/

/* Custom, iPhone Retina */
@media only screen and (min-width : 320px) {

}

/* Extra Small Devices, Phones */
@media only screen and (min-width : 480px) {

}

/* Small Devices, Tablets */
@media only screen and (min-width : 768px) {

}

/* Medium Devices, Desktops */
@media only screen and (min-width : 992px) {

}

 /* Large Devices, Wide Screens */
@media only screen and (min-width : 1200px) {

}


